Universal Design for Learning (UDL)

This is an introductory course on Universal Design for Learning (UDL) that provides a foundation for developing accessible courses and demonstrates the potential of UDL to make teaching resources and practices more responsive to students' diverse needs and contexts.

What you'll learn

  • Demonstrate an understanding of UDL
  • Describe the various barriers students may experience when accessing learning materials
  • Create accessible learning resources using principles of UDL
  • Implement practice of UDL in your institutions
  • Advocate for policy supporting frameworks for providing accessible learning experiences for students with disabilities

Topics covered

  • Topic 1: Introduction to UDL
  • Topic 2: Personas and Assistive Technology
  • Topic 3: Text and Tables
  • Topic 4: Images and Colour
  • Topic 5: Equations
  • Topic 6: Video and Audio
  • Topic 7: Synchronous lectures
  • Topic 8: Implementing UDL
  • Topic 9: UDL in Policy and Practice
